Position Duties & Responsibilities
- Lead UX/UI strategy for Z SUPPLY’s e‑commerce platforms, balancing performance, brand storytelling, and customer‑centric design.
- Own the end‑to‑end design process: from concept development and wireframing to final UI and handoff.
- Design and optimize engaging, responsive experiences across web and mobile that drive engagement and conversion.
- Collaborate closely with E‑Commerce, Merchandising, Marketing, and Development teams to align design with business goals.
- Leverage user research, A/B testing, analytics, and heatmaps to inform design decisions and continuously iterate on solutions.
- Maintain and evolve our design system in Figma to ensure visual consistency and scalable design practices.
- Partner with CRO Manager to develop and test hypotheses aimed at improving user experience and business KPIs.
- Ensure accessibility, usability, and best practices are incorporated into every design.
- Work hands‑on with front‑end developers to ensure pixel‑perfect implementation and a smooth handoff process.
- Use tools like Asana to manage design workflows, track timelines, and meet project deadlines.
- Stay ahead of UX/UI trends, tools, and technologies to bring fresh ideas and best practices to the team.
Qualifications & Skills
-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Digital Design, Fine Arts, or a related field preferred.
- 7‑10+ years of UX/UI and digital design experience, with a strong emphasis on e‑commerce and women’s apparel.
- Expertise in Figma is required.
-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, After Effects), Adobe XD, and Asana. Video editing and/or hand illustration skills are a plus.
- Strong project management and time management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.
- A portfolio showcasing strategic thinking, strong UI design, and a deep understanding of UX best practices.
- Ability to identify user needs, anticipate behavior, and translate findings into seamless, intuitive design solutions.
- Strong visual design sensibility, including typography, color theory, spacing, layout, and composition.
- Understanding of how UX design impacts KPIs: bounce rate, conversion rate, engagement, and retention.
- A self‑starter with excellent communication, problem‑solving, and collaboration skills.
